Each bowl includes a pure quartz mallet wrapped in premium silicone for optimal resonance, plus a silicone O-ring for stable playing on hard surfaces. The O-ring allows the bowl to resonate freely without dampening. The bowl itself is formed in a single seamless vessel from 99.998% pure quartz—no welds, no weak points—with lavender integrated at the molecular level during formation.
